Innovative program and expanded coverage Light up Macao 2022 will come into the spotlight in December

Organized by Macao Government Tourism Office (MGTO) and in partnership with local enterprises, the event “Light up Macao 2022” will illuminate eight districts across Macao Peninsula, Taipa and Coloane with a kaleidoscope of light arts under the theme of “Dazzling Winter” from 3 December 2022 to 1 January 2023. The event weaves together Macao’s diverse gems of cultural tourism, public art and innovative technology to light up Macao through integration of “tourism +”. It will not just radiate the glamour of Macao as a safe and wonderful destination but also stimulate the tourism economy.




Tap Siac Craft Market in autumn continues to be held from Thursday to Sunday

Organised by the Cultural Affairs Bureau (IC, from the Portuguese acronym), the Tap Siac Craft Market in autumn will continue to be held from 24 to 27 November (Thursday to Sunday) at Tap Siac Square, featuring a new and vast array of cultural and creative brands. The public is welcome to visit and enjoy the creative atmosphere while shopping for cultural and creative products.


UM PhD student’s research discovery to help develop novel nonlinear optical devices

Wang Gang, a PhD student in the Institute of Applied Physics and Materials Engineering (IAPME), University of Macau (UM), has discovered an abnormal nonlinear optics conversion in quasi-2D perovskite materials, which is a breakthrough in understanding the nonlinear optical absorption of low-dimensional semiconductors and will pave the way for the development of novel nonlinear optical devices such as all-optical switches and pulsed laser. The research results have been published in the internationally-renowned journal Nature Communications

Survey on manpower needs and wages for the 3rd quarter of 2022 – Financial activities

The Statistics and Census Service (DSEC) released results of the Survey on Manpower Needs and Wages of Financial Activities for the third quarter of 2022. The Survey covers the Banking Sector, Other Financial Intermediation, Insurance Activities, and Activities Auxiliary to Financial Intermediation, including financial institutions supervised by the Monetary Authority of Macao, but excluding insurance agents and brokers not directly employed by insurance companies.



Singing Club recruitment New voices wanted at CCM

The Macao Cultural Centre, under the auspices of the Cultural Affairs Bureau, is recruiting a new wave of young voices to join its Singing Club. Applications are now open to children and youth aged eight to 16, wishing to explore their vocal skills and enhance their artistic insights.
